Strobilurin fungicides are a class of agricultural chemicals derived from natural antifungal compounds produced by certain fungi, used to protect crops by inhibiting mitochondrial respiration in pathogenic fungi.
There is an increasing emphasis on farming practices that are environmentally friendly and sustainable. Strobilurin fungicides are considered more eco-efficient than many older fungicides because they work effectively in small doses and degrade safely. Their targeted action also means fewer applications are needed, reducing chemical use and environmental load. Farmers are encouraged or even incentivized to use advanced, low-impact fungicides as governments and international organizations push for greener agriculture. This shift toward sustainable crop protection is boosting the adoption of modern strobilurin formulations in various regions, from large-scale farms to smaller agricultural operations, thereby driving the market growth.

Climate change and intensive farming practices are contributing to the spread of fungal diseases across various crops. Warmer temperatures and higher humidity levels create ideal conditions for fungi to thrive. Crops such as wheat, rice, soybeans, and fruits are frequently affected by fungal infections that significantly reduce yields. Strobilurin fungicides are highly effective in controlling a broad spectrum of these diseases. Their preventive and curative action helps farmers manage disease outbreaks efficiently. The demand for effective solutions like strobilurins continues to rise as the threat from fungal pathogens grows, especially in high-value crops, thereby driving the market growth.
